The Power of the .50 BMG Cartridge: A Contextual Overview

The .50 BMG (Browning Machine Gun) cartridge is a legend in itself, renowned for its immense power and versatility. Originally developed for military heavy machine guns, it has evolved into a formidable round for anti-materiel rifles, extreme long-range precision shooting, and even specialized hunting.

Historical Significance and Evolution:

  • Born from Necessity: Designed by John M. Browning at the end of World War I, the .50 BMG was developed to counter armored targets and low-flying aircraft. Its military heritage is deeply ingrained in its robust design.
  • Diverse Applications: From the M2 Browning machine gun to modern anti-materiel rifles like the Barrett M82, McMillan Tac-50, and Serbu BFG-50, the .50 BMG has proven its adaptability across various platforms.
  • Civilian Adoption: Its raw power and inherent accuracy captured the imagination of civilian shooters, leading to its adoption in extreme long-range target shooting and niche hunting scenarios.

The Science Behind Monolithic Copper Bullets

The shift from traditional lead-core bullets to monolithic copper designs represents a significant advancement in bullet technology, particularly for demanding applications.

Key Advantages of Monolithic Construction:

  1. Superior Accuracy: Precision machining of a single material ensures near-perfect concentricity and balance. This eliminates inconsistencies that can occur with jacketed lead-core bullets, such as core shift or uneven jacket thickness, leading to tighter groups downrange.
  2. Consistent Terminal Performance: Because the bullet maintains its mass and integrity on impact, it delivers more predictable penetration and energy transfer. There's no jacket to separate or lead core to deform unpredictably. For anti-materiel roles, this means consistent barrier penetration.
  3. Enhanced Penetration: The hardness and structural integrity of solid copper allow these bullets to penetrate tough barriers like steel, concrete, or dense bone with greater efficiency than many lead-core alternatives.
  4. Reduced Fouling: Copper-based bullets often result in less barrel fouling compared to lead, contributing to longer barrel life and sustained accuracy over extended shooting sessions.
  5. Environmental Responsibility: With increasing regulations and environmental awareness, lead-free bullets are becoming a necessity in many shooting areas and for certain types of hunting. Barnes TAC-X bullets provide a high-performance, environmentally friendly option.

Reloading with Barnes TAC-X50 Bullets: A Guide for Precision

For the serious reloader, crafting custom .50 BMG ammunition with Barnes TAC-X50 bullets is a rewarding process that allows for fine-tuning performance to a specific rifle. Here's what reloaders need to consider:

  • Start Low, Work Up: Always begin with published reloading data for monolithic copper bullets and work up charges incrementally. Pressure characteristics can differ from traditional lead-core bullets.
  • Case Preparation: Meticulous case sizing, trimming, chamfering, and deburring are crucial for optimal concentricity and consistent neck tension.
  • Primer Selection: Use large rifle magnum primers specifically designed for the .50 BMG, as consistent ignition is vital for such a large powder charge.
  • Powder Choice: Select powders with appropriate burn rates for the .50 BMG, typically slow-burning powders designed for large capacity cases. Consult reputable reloading manuals for specific recommendations.
  • Seating Depth: Experiment with seating depth (Overall Length - OAL) to find the "sweet spot" for your rifle. This often involves adjusting the bullet jump to the rifling for optimal accuracy. Due to the solid construction, these bullets are often seated deeper than traditional bullets to compensate for their length.
  • Crimping: A light, consistent crimp can aid in ignition consistency and ensure the heavy bullet doesn't move under recoil, though many precision reloaders prefer no crimp or a very light taper crimp.
  • Bullet Runout: Use a concentricity gauge to ensure minimal runout, which is critical for long-range accuracy.

The Barnes TAC-X50 .510 647 Grain bullets are designed for performance, and proper reloading techniques unlock their full potential. Always prioritize safety and consult multiple, current reloading manuals.
